An exciting and rare opportunity has arisen for a band 3 Community Health Care Support Worker to work within the Pembrokeshire Community Clinics, based in South Pembrokeshire Hospital. The post holder will be required to work within Leg Ulcer, Well Leg, Catheter and Earwax Management Clinics. The post is part-time, 30 hours per week, working between Monday to Friday, 9am-5pm.

The ability to speak Welsh is desirable for this post; English and/or Welsh speakers are equally welcome to apply.

Interviews will be held on 30/5/24

**As a senior healthcare support worker you will**:
Be responsible for the delivery of a high standard of cost effective nursing care, as part of a nursing team, in support of and under the guidance and delegation of the Senior Sister or designated representative.

Ensure that patients/clients receive safe, individualised and effective standards of care by following care plans and treatment interventions as delegated by the registered nurse overcoming barriers to understanding as they present.

Under delegation of the nurse in charge of the caseload, work competently and without direct supervision, within a framework that has been agreed by the Senior Sister/Team Leader.

When accepting delegated activities it is the post holder’s responsibility to make sure that patient and public safety is not affected.

Communicate effectively at all times with patients and their carers in conjunction with other team members, contributing to and maintaining the team philosophy.

Act as a role model for other health care support workers and student nurses.

Hywel Dda University Health Board is the planner and provider of NHS healthcare services for people in Carmarthenshire, Ceredigion, Pembrokeshire and its bordering counties. Our 12,000 members of staff provide primary, community, in-hospital, mental health and learning disabilities services for around 384,000 people across a quarter of the landmass of Wales. We do this in partnership with our three local authorities and public, private and third sector colleagues, including our volunteers, through:
**Four main hospitals**: Bronglais General in Aberystwyth, Glangwili General in Carmarthen, Prince Philip in Llanelli and Withybush General in Haverfordwest;
**Seven community hospitals**: Amman Valley and Llandovery in Carmarthenshire; Tregaron, Aberaeron and Cardigan in Ceredigion; and Tenby and South Pembrokeshire Hospital Health and Social Care Resource Centre in Pembrokeshire;
48 general practices (six of which are managed practices), 47 dental practices (including three orthodontic), 99 community pharmacies, 44 general ophthalmic practices (43 providing Eye Health Examination Wales and 34 low vision services) and 17 domiciliary only providers and 11 health centres;
Numerous locations providing mental health and learning disabilities services;
Highly specialised and tertiary services commissioned by the Welsh Health Specialised Services Committee, a joint committee representing seven health boards across Wales.
